Cristiano Ronaldo's future at Al Nassr has been thrown into uncertainty following a surprising statement from the head of the Saudi Pro League. The Portuguese superstar, who joined the club in January 2023, has been a significant figure in the league, drawing global attention and boosting the profile of Saudi football.

Saudi Pro League chief, Saad Allazeez, hinted that Ronaldo's contract situation might be more fluid than previously thought. Speaking at a recent press conference, Allazeez suggested that while Ronaldo's presence has been beneficial, the league is prepared to move forward with or without him. This revelation has sparked widespread speculation about Ronaldo's next move, with fans and pundits alike questioning whether the 38-year-old will remain in Saudi Arabia or seek new challenges elsewhere.

Ronaldo's impact on Al Nassr and the Saudi Pro League cannot be understated. His arrival led to a surge in viewership and an increase in the league's international visibility. However, with his contract set to expire in June 2025, the possibility of an early departure has now become a topic of intense discussion. As the situation develops, all eyes will be on Ronaldo and his next career move, which could have significant implications for both Al Nassr and the Saudi Pro League.
